Effects of special period of circulatory posture intervention combined with empathic psychological nursing on coping style and sleep quality of patients with ocular trauma after vitrectomy
Objective To explore the effects of special period of circulatory posture intervention combined with empathic psychological nursing on coping style and sleep quality of patients with ocular trauma after vitrectomy.Methods A total of 200 patients with ocular trauma after vitrectomy admitted from December 2019 to December 2021 were selected and randomly divided into control group and observation group,with 100 cases in each group.The control group was given routine nursing intervention,and the observation group was given special period of circulatory posture intervention combined with empathic psychological nursing.The intervention effects of the two groups were compared.Results After intervention,the face score of the observation group was higher than that of the control group,and the avoidance and yield scores were lower than those of the control group(P<0.05).After intervention,the scores of each dimension of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index(PSQI)in the observation group were lower than those in the control group(P<0.05).The incidence of postoperative discomfort in the observation group was lower than that in the control group(P<0.05).After intervention,the best corrected visual acuity of the observation group was better than that of the control group(P<0.05).Conclusion The special period of circulatory posture intervention combined with empathic psychological nursing can improve the coping style and sleep quality of patients with ocular trauma after vitrectomy,reduce postoperative discomfort symptoms and elevate the effect of visual recovery,which is worthy of promotion.
